Title :
Using the Parallel Research Kernels to Study PGAS Models
Author :
Rob F. Van der Wijngaart;Srinivas Sridharan;Abdullah Kayi;Gabriele Jost;Jeff R. Hammond;Timothy G. Mattson;Jacob E. Nelson
Author_Institution :
Univ. of Washington, Seattle, WA, USA
Abstract :
A subset of the Parallel Research Kernels (PRK),simplified parallel application patterns, are used to study the behavior of different runtimes implementing the PGAS programming model. The goal of this paper is to show that such an approach is practical and effective as we approach the exascale era. Our experimental results indicate that forthe kernels we selected, MPI with two-sided communications outperforms the PGAS runtimes SHMEM, UPC, Grappa, and MPI-3 with RMA extensions.
Keywords :
"Kernel","Runtime","Synchronization","Electronics packaging","Programming","Bandwidth","Protocols"
Conference_Titel :
Partitioned Global Address Space Programming Models (PGAS), 2015 9th International Conference on
DOI :
10.1109/PGAS.2015.24